I have a G&L L-2000 bass that is in great condition except for the electronics & pickups. At band rehearsal about a week ago the bass and I took a lightning hit. I faired ok but the pickups did not. The fine copper wires in the pickup windings were damaged. I have no idea about the condition of the Pots, Switches & Preamp. They look fine but you never know. The rest of the bass is in excellent condition (see pics below). Since I have 5 other basses I have decided not to spend the money on getting or repairing the pickups and electronics. It was a shock but during the electrical storm. We had one of those big strikes and all the power went out. When we got power back the bass still had signal but it was very low. Only 1 coil was working in each pickup so split pickup worked but not series and the Preamp worked. So after opening up we found fraying on the copper wiring on the pickups. That what took the hit.
